How can I recognize one? but when we want to count distinct column combinations, we must either clumsily concatenate values (and be very careful to choose the right separator): select count (distinct col1 || '-' || col2) from mytable; or use a subquery: select count (*) from (select distinct col1, col2 from mytable); So I am looking for something along the lines of: What are the options for storing hierarchical data in a relational database?
